projects
/
oota-llvm.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
841e828
)
fix an infinite loop in Module::getEndianness, PR6684
author
Chris Lattner
<sabre@nondot.org>
Tue, 23 Mar 2010 21:48:41 +0000
(21:48 +0000)
committer
Chris Lattner
<sabre@nondot.org>
Tue, 23 Mar 2010 21:48:41 +0000
(21:48 +0000)
patch by Alex Mac!
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@99330
91177308
-0d34-0410-b5e6-
96231b3b80d8
lib/VMCore/Module.cpp
patch
|
blob
|
history
diff --git
a/lib/VMCore/Module.cpp
b/lib/VMCore/Module.cpp
index 001bb00f26ba48fde19d380df156ed495e662b3c..94840f07a4abf82857f9566557b63d41600e9add 100644
(file)
--- a/
lib/VMCore/Module.cpp
+++ b/
lib/VMCore/Module.cpp
@@
-82,7
+82,7
@@
Module::Endianness Module::getEndianness() const {
while (!temp.empty()) {
StringRef token = DataLayout;
- tie(token, temp) = getToken(
DataLayout
, "-");
+ tie(token, temp) = getToken(
temp
, "-");
if (token[0] == 'e') {
ret = LittleEndian;